Knowledge the Core Principles of Hydraulic Technology

At the heart of hydraulic Technology is Pascal's Legislation, which states that stress placed on a confined fluid is transmitted undiminished in all directions. This basic principle allows for the era of immense pressure with reasonably little enter Power, earning hydraulics ideal for heavy-duty responsibilities. Hydraulic programs usually include a pump (which generates flow), valves (which Regulate course, pressure, and stream), actuators (which transform hydraulic Vitality into mechanical motion), and fluid reservoirs.

Using hydraulic fluids—typically oil—permits systems to make, control, and direct Power with exceptional precision. Contrary to mechanical methods, the place friction may lead to put on and tear, hydraulic programs use fluid to develop smooth movement, which minimizes maintenance needs and improves sturdiness. This adaptability can make hydraulics necessary in industries in which large loads, substantial precision, or intricate movements are required.

Essential Programs of Hydraulic Technology Across Industries

Hydraulics Participate in a critical role in many sectors, such as design, producing, and transportation. In the construction Industry, As an example, hydraulics are classified as the backbone of apparatus for example excavators, bulldozers, cranes, and backhoes. These machines rely on hydraulic Power to elevate, drive, and shift enormous loads effortlessly. The construction of skyscrapers, highways, and bridges wouldn't be feasible with no force and flexibility of hydraulic equipment.

In producing, hydraulic presses and forming machines form and mildew supplies with precision. The ability to use steady, managed stress allows manufacturers to work with metals, plastics, and other resources efficiently. Irrespective of whether It really is stamping motor vehicle areas or shaping fragile Digital factors, hydraulics make sure producing procedures are both strong and exact.

During the transportation sector, hydraulics are integral to the operation of plane, ships, and vehicles. Aircraft use hydraulic devices to regulate landing gear, brakes, and flight Management surfaces, while ships use hydraulics for steering, winching, and cargo handling. In automobiles, Power steering and braking methods rely on hydraulic mechanisms to deliver drivers with control and basic safety. The usage of hydraulics in these programs enables sleek and reputable Procedure, especially in techniques the place mechanical Power by yourself could well be inadequate.

Advantages of Hydraulic Methods Over Mechanical and Electrical Systems

One of the best strengths of hydraulic methods is their power to create enormous amounts of pressure in the compact space. Though mechanical systems have to have huge components to supply identical force, hydraulic techniques can reach higher Power density from the usage of fluid pressure. This allows for smaller sized, additional productive designs which might be effective at carrying out large-responsibility responsibilities with out occupying extreme Room.

Also, hydraulic units offer outstanding Regulate and precision. The ability to fantastic-tune stress and circulation enables operators to execute tasks having a higher diploma of precision. This is particularly crucial in industries like aerospace, the place even the smallest deviation in movement or force might have really serious outcomes. In contrast to electrical methods, which can put up with interference or Power reduction, hydraulic methods supply consistent, reliable Power even in complicated environments.

One more advantage is the durability and robustness of hydraulic methods. Using fluid in place of reliable mechanical linkages minimizes friction and don, which prolongs the lifespan on the equipment. This tends to make hydraulic units additional appropriate for severe environments, including mining functions or offshore oil rigs, where equipment is subjected to Excessive pressures, temperatures, and corrosive components.

Technological Progress and the Future of Hydraulic Units

The evolution of hydraulic Technology proceeds, pushed by advancements in supplies, style and design, and automation. Contemporary hydraulic units are becoming much more productive, lessening energy usage and increasing overall performance. One example is, variable displacement pumps and cargo-sensing Technology enable For additional specific control of fluid circulation, which minimizes Electricity squander and improves General system performance.

Also, The combination of digital systems and automation is reworking hydraulic devices into sensible methods. Sensors, controllers, and serious-time monitoring resources are getting used to optimize hydraulic general performance, predict routine maintenance demands, and improve protection. These improvements are paving the way in which for hydraulic units to Enjoy a crucial function in the event of autonomous machines and robotic methods, particularly in industries like manufacturing, agriculture, and logistics.

As environmental fears expand, the Industry can also be concentrating on creating a lot more sustainable hydraulic programs. New fluid formulations which are biodegradable and environmentally friendly are increasingly being made, and hydraulic techniques have gotten more Power-productive to lessen their environmental effects. These breakthroughs are important as industries request to balance the need for Power and performance Using the need for sustainability.
